Twine
Twine

Description: Twine is an open-source tool for creating interactive, nonlinear stories and games. It allows users to create 'passages' of text or images that link together into branching narratives without needing to write code.

Twine
Twine Features
  • Visual editor for creating passages and connecting them
  • Support for text, images, CSS, JavaScript
  • Export stories to web, desktop apps, or ebook formats
  • Collaborative editing and version control
  • Plugin architecture to extend functionality
